FTCS vs FNY
First Trust Capital Strength ETF vs First Trust Mid Cap Growth AlphaDEX Fund
Key differences
- FTCS costs 0.20% less per year.
- FTCS is significantly larger than FNY — larger funds tend to be more liquid and less likely to close.
- Over the last 3 years, FNY has delivered higher annualized returns.
- FTCS has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
